在Ubuntu虚拟机中设置和应用Swap分区,可以显著提高系统的性能和稳定性,尤其是在物理内存有限的情况下。以下是详细的步骤:
创建Swap文件:
sudo dd if=/dev/zero of=/swapfile bs=1M count=4096
这里的count=4096
表示创建了一个4GB大小的Swap文件。sudo mkswap /swapfile
sudo swapon /swapfile
/etc/fstab
文件:echo '/swapfile none swap sw 0 0' | sudo tee -a /etc/fstab
创建Swap分区:
fdisk
或gparted
等工具创建一个Swap分区。sudo mkswap /dev/sdXY
其中/dev/sdXY
是你创建的分区,例如/dev/sda2
。sudo swapon /dev/sdXY
/etc/fstab
以便自动挂载。free -h
命令查看Swap的使用情况,帮助了解系统内存和Swap的平衡状态。通过以上步骤,你可以在Ubuntu虚拟机中成功设置和应用Swap,从而优化系统性能。